  • In this video we have discussed the Plant Pathogen Interaction. We know when the Pathogen comes in contact with the plant cell , it tries to inject its proteins and other factors in order to hijack the cellular system but it does not go all it way because plants use defensive mechanism for it what we call as PTI and ETI. PTI stands for Pattern or PAMP triggered immunity while as ETI stands for Effector Triggered immunity. PTI triggers MAPK pathway while ETI triggers Hormonal Signalling like Salicylic Acid pathway and Jasmonic acid pathway. In both of these immunities plants express defensive genes to combat the pathogen infecion.

    That was a good summary. There was one aspect that I thought was lacking though. The way it is presented here makes it seem like a very one dimensional process; i.e. fungus attacks a plant and the plant defends against it. I think it would've been good to also mention that many of those effectors are high selective pressure to not be detected and change rapidly. Furthermore, there are effectors whose role is to disrupt and prevent those plant defences from happening. So you have the fungus attacking the plant, the plant defending and the fungus counter attacking. And whenever there is a successful infection, that means the counter attacks were able to overwhelm or prevent the plant defence response.
